										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>TEHRAN (<a href="https://irannewsdaily.com/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Iran News</a>) – The Syrian Constitutional Committee, which began its first session in nine months in Geneva on Monday as part of efforts to find a political solution to the Syrian crisis war, was swiftly put “on hold” after three members tested positive for COVID-19, the United Nations said.</p>
<div class="story" data-readmoretitle="Read more">
<p>On Monday, US Syria envoy James Jeffrey told reporters that the government of Syrian President Bashar al-Assad had agreed to take part in the week-long Syrian Constitutional Committee amid COVID-19 outbreak.</p>
<p>The session, organized by UN Special Envoy Geir Pedersen, is aimed at making make progress in drafting a new Syrian charter to pave the way for UN-sponsored elections, in line with a stalled 2015 UN Security Council resolution.</p>
<p>The office of UN Special Envoy for Syria Geir Pedersen did not identify which three of the 45 members of the Constitutional Committee were infected. One third is nominated by the Syrian government, one third by the opposition, and one third by civil society.</p>
<p>“Committee members were tested before they travelled to Geneva, and they were tested again on arrival, and the wearing of masks and strict social distancing measures were in place when they met at the Palais des Nations,” the statement said, Reuters reported.</p>
<p>“Following a constructive first meeting, the Third Session of the Constitutional Committee is currently on hold. The Office of the Special Envoy will make a further announcement in due course,” it said, adding that Swiss authorities had been informed and contact-tracing was underway.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>TEHRAN (<a href="https://irannewsdaily.com/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Iran News</a>) – A US serviceman was killed in Syria on Tuesday, according to military officials in the region.</p>
<div class="story" data-readmoretitle="Read more">
<p>The individual, whose service branch hasn’t been released yet, was assigned to the Operation Inherent Resolve coalition.</p>
<p>“Initial reports indicate the incident was not due to enemy contact,” reads a brief Inherent Resolve press release sent Tuesday afternoon, Army Times reported.</p>
<p>“The incident is under investigation.”</p>
<p>The individual’s identity will be released after their next of kin have been notified, Inherent Resolve officials stated.</p>
<p>There have been four hostile deaths and five non-combat deaths under the Inherent Resolve mission this year. All of the combat deaths have been in Iraq.</p>
<p>An airman and a soldier were killed in mid-March during a rocket attack on Camp Taji. Prior to that, two Marine Raiders were killed in Iraq’s southern Makhmur Mountains.</p>
<p>Nearly 150 US service members have been wounded in action this year, as well. One Marine, 10 airmen and 138 soldiers have been wounded in combat in 2020, according to Pentagon data.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>TEHRAN (<a href="https://irannewsdaily.com/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Iran News</a>) – President Hassan Rouhani said there is &#8220;no military solution&#8221; to Syria on Wednesday during a videoconference with his counterparts in Russia and Turkey, Vladimir Putin and Recep Tayyip Erdogan about the war-torn country.</p>
<div class="itemcontent">
<p>&#8220;The Islamic Republic believes the only solution to the Syrian crisis is political and not a military solution,&#8221; Rouhani said in a televised opening address.</p>
<p>&#8220;We continue to support the inter-Syrian dialogue and underline our determination to fight the terrorism of Daesh, Al-Qaeda, and other related groups.&#8221;</p>
<p>&#8220;I emphasize that the fight against terrorism will continue until it is completely eradicated in Syria and the region in general,&#8221; he added.</p>
<p>Rouhani said the illegitimate presence of US forces in Syria should end immediately.</p>
<p>Iran would continue its support for Syria’s legal government, he added.</p>
<p>The Iranian president also condemned “unilateral and inhumane sanctions” imposed by the US on Syria, calling the move an act of “economic terrorism” that violates international law, human rights, and the sovereignty of Syria.</p>
<p>Putin told his counterparts that there was a need for peaceful dialogue between the opposing forces in Syria’s war.</p>
<p>Putin said hotspots of terrorism still remain in Syria’s Idlib and other regions.</p>
<p>“An inclusive inter-Syrian dialogue should be actively promoted within the framework of the constitutional committee in Geneva. I propose to support this process, to help the participants meet and start a direct dialogue,” Putin said.</p>
<p>In Syria’s nine-year-old war, Russia and Iran are the main foreign supporters of President Bashar al-Assad’s forces, while Turkey backs militants. Under a diplomatic process dating back to 2017, they agreed to work to reduce fighting.</p>
<p>After worsening violence displaced nearly a million people, Turkey and Russia agreed in March to halt hostilities in northwest Syria’s Idlib region.</p>
<p>Erdogan told the videoconference that the priority for Syria is a lasting solution to the conflict, “achievement of calm in the field and the protection of Syria’s political unity and territorial integrity”.</p>
<p>“We will continue to do all we can so that our neighbor Syria finds peace, security and stability soon,” he said.</p>
<p>The talks are the first since September in the so-called Astana format, in which the three powers discuss developments in Syria.</p>
<p>The three presidents also issued a joint statement in which they “expressed their determination to stand against separatist agendas aimed at undermining the sovereignty and territorial integrity of Syria as well as threatening the national security of neighboring countries.”</p>
<p>They also voiced “their opposition to the illegal seizure and transfer of oil revenues that should belong to the Syrian Arab Republic.”</p>
<p>The statement noted that “the Syrian conflict could only be resolved through the Syrian-led and Syrian-owned, UN-facilitated political process in line with the UN Security Council Resolution 2254.”</p>
<p>It also highlighted the need to “facilitate the safe and voluntary return of refugees and internally displaced persons to their original places of residence in Syria, ensuring their right to return and right to be supported.”</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>TEHRAN (<a href="https://irannewsdaily.com/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Iran News</a>) &#8211; Turkey shot down a Syrian fighter jet in Syria&#8217;s Idlib province Tuesday, as steady clashes between the two national armies continued.</p>
<div class="itemcontent">
<p>State-run Syrian media said troops shot down a Turkish drone, keeping up a clash in the skies over the northwestern province that has gone on for days and signaled a new stage in the 9-year-old war, AP reported.</p>
<p>The Turkish Defense Ministry announced on Twitter that its forces downed an L-39 jet belonging to Syrian government forces. The Syrian military said Turkish forces targeted a warplane with a missile as it was carrying out operations against “terrorist groups” in the militant-held Idlib region, causing it to crash northwest of the town of Maaret al-Numan. The fate of the crew was not clear.</p>
<p>Turkey has sent thousands of troops into Idlib to support the militants holed up there but hasn&#8217;t been able to roll back the Syrian government&#8217;s advance.</p>
<p>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dogan has said he hopes to broker a cease-fire in Syria later this week when he meets with Russian President Vladimir Putin in Moscow.</p>
<p>The Russian-backed offensive of the Syrian Army into the country&#8217;s last militant-held area has led to increasingly frequent clashes between the Syrian and Turkish armies that have killed dozens on both sides.</p>
<p>A Turkish soldier was killed and another wounded Monday night, Turkey&#8217;s Defense Ministry said, raising to 55 the number of Turkish losses this month in clashes with Syrian forces. The death toll includes 33 Turkish soldiers killed Thursday in a single airstrike.</p>
<p>Tensions in Idlib rose following the Syrian strike that killed the 33 Turkish soldiers. Turkey responded with drone attacks and shelling that it says have killed more than 90 Syrian troops and allied fighters.</p>
<p>The Turkish air force said on Sunday it shot down two Syrian warplanes after Syria&#8217;s air defenses shot down one of its drones. The Syrian pilots ejected safely.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>TEHRAN (<a href="https://irannewsdaily.com/"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">Iran News</a>) &#8211; A Syrian military source said the Arab country has closed its airspace over northwest Idlib, warning that any aircraft that violates it will be regarded as “hostile” and shot down.</p>
<p>&#8220;Any aircraft that breaches the Syrian airspace over Idlib will be dealt with as a hostile aircraft that must be downed and prevented from achieving their hostile goals,&#8221; the source said, SANA reported.</p>
<p>The army has taken the measure based on its adherence to &#8220;constitutional and national duties in defending the sovereignty of the state and protecting its security and territorial integrity,” it added.</p>
<p>The source also lashed out at Turkish forces for carrying out &#8220;hostile acts&#8221; against the Syrian armed forces by directly targeting their positions in Idlib and its adjacent areas and providing support to armed terrorist organizations.</p>
<p>&#8220;These repeated hostile Turkish acts will not succeed in saving terrorists from the strikes of the Syrian Arab Army and they prove the Turkish regime’s disavowal of all the previous agreements including Sochi memo,&#8221; it added.</p>
<p>The decision to shut the airspace came after the Syrian army downed a Turkish drone over the strategic city of Saraqib, which lies on the intersection of the M5 and M4 highways.</p>
<p>Over the past few weeks, tensions have escalated between Ankara and Damascus in Idlib, the only large territory in the hands of terrorists.</p>
<p>The Syrian military has managed to undo militant gains across the Arab country and bring back almost all of the Syrian soil under government control.</p>
